  • Looking for fun and engaging volunteer opportunities? We have many independent craft project ideas to help you earn service hours, keep you busy and engaged, and contribute to a good cause, all at the same time! You can do this from anywhere.


    Samaritan is a not-for-profit agency based in Mount Laurel, NJ caring for people suffering from serious, progressive illness and grief. Your projects are delivered to our patients and their families to help brighten their day!


    Choose one or multiple projects and work at your leisure. Projects may be mailed or delivered to: Samaritan, Attn: Sharon Wenner, 3906 Church Rd., Mount Laurel, NJ 08054. Deliver Mon-Fri, 8:30a-4:30p (excluding 12-1p).


    “Cheer Up” Project Ideas



    • Bookmark “monsters” - www.easypeasyandfun.com/diy-corner-bookmarks/

    • Clay Hearts – make marbled-color clay hearts for our staff to present to our families when their loved one passes. NOTE: We will provide specific instructions and supply list.

    • Blank journals with decorated covers (NO words/phrases)

    • Notecard Sets – decorate blank cards/cardstock for our families to use – do not include your own message.

    • Picture books – take a variety of nature photos, print, and bind to make a pretty picture book.

    • Texture Books – use items of various textures (sandpaper, feathers, cotton balls…) & adhere to cardstock pages. This is interactive for patients with dementia and Alzheimer’s who can’t communicate verbally.

    • Poetry Books – bind together short poems and inspirational quotes. Add clip art, stickers, photos, etc.

    • Silk Flower crafts: corsages, decorated pens, small potted arrangements

    • Wreaths

    • Homemade sachets – greatly appreciate by our Massage Therapy staff!

    • Balloon Stress Balls (filled w/ craft sand)

    • Pillows – hand-tie or sewLap blankets – quilt, crochet, knit, fleece, tied

    • For Veterans – flag pins, carnation boutonnieres, letters/cards, or any above item decorated patriotically



    When safe, we will resume our SamariTeens program, our ongoing teen volunteer group, that meets in Mount Laurel and Voorhees, NJ one evening per month rotating locations, from 6-7:30pm, to make crafts for our patients and families to help bring some joy to their day. We also visit assisted living residences to play games with the residents. You also have the opportunity to represent Samaritan at teen volunteer fairs by manning an information table, participate in fundraisers, collection drives, and support annual events.

    The cool thing? There are no mandatory requirements - you attend as many activities that fit your schedule and that you’d enjoy.
